I can't help you in QRoo but if you have a week or so and a van I can tell you that they make gorgeous carved furniture in the Petén of Guatemala, about a days drive if you hustle but easier if you take 2 days. As close as El Remate, just outside the gates to Tikal and only a couple hours from the Belize border, they make a lot of hardwood furniture. Farther down (2 more hours driving) in Poptun they also do incredible work with beautiful types of wood. I was recently through there and drooling over some of the doors and furniture. I saw one door that was 3D relief of the tree of life, subtly stained and completely cut through in parts. They said they would fill the spaces with glass for an interior door or wood for exterior. It was made of rosewood, a really beautiful hardwood. Cost was approx $300 US. If I needed furniture I think it would be worth it to drive down and buy it there. Check with Belize customs first of course to see if they have restrictions on bringing it through.
